后端
ClementQL
没有努力,天赋一无是处!
展开
-
C# 泛型接口(2)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 interface IMyIfc<T> // G...原创 2019-02-15 10:33:14 · 225 阅读 · 0 评论 -
C# 泛型与继承
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 class Animal { public string Name; } ...原创 2019-02-15 10:34:03 · 1467 阅读 · 0 评论 -
C# 事件案例
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 public delegate void DelPublish();//声明事件所需的委托(代理) cla...原创 2019-02-15 11:05:08 · 740 阅读 · 0 评论 -
C# 事件案例 (事件触发多方法)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 public delegate void DelPublish();//声明事件所需的委托(代理) cla...原创 2019-02-15 11:06:28 · 5166 阅读 · 0 评论 -
C# 认识委托1(无返回值和参数的委托)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 //委托(代理)和类一样,是数据类型,等同于c++的函数指针。可以看做是个特殊的类。格式:delegate 返回值...原创 2019-02-15 11:14:55 · 2746 阅读 · 0 评论 -
C# 认识委托2(无返回值和参数的委托)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 //委托(代理)和类一样,是数据类型,等同于c++的函数指针。可以看做是个特殊的类。格式:delegate 返回值...原创 2019-02-15 11:17:38 · 415 阅读 · 0 评论 -
C# 调用带返回值的委托
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;//调用带返回值的委托。如果方法列表中有多个方法,//则最后一个方法的返回值就是委托的返回值,其他方法的返回值都被忽略。namespace Examples...原创 2019-02-15 11:21:36 · 8571 阅读 · 0 评论 -
C# 调用带引用参数的委托
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 delegate void MyDel(ref int X); class MyClass {...原创 2019-02-15 11:22:13 · 2462 阅读 · 0 评论 -
C# 委托中的匿名方法常用(初始化委托实例)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 delegate int OtherDel(int InParam); class Program ...原创 2019-02-15 11:22:56 · 375 阅读 · 0 评论 -
C# lambda拉姆达表达式基础(匿名方法的升级版)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ace Examples{ delegate double MyDel(int par); class Program {...原创 2019-02-15 11:23:35 · 1499 阅读 · 0 评论 -
C# 委托拉姆达
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ace 委托拉姆达{ class Program { //delega...原创 2019-02-15 11:24:15 · 416 阅读 · 0 评论 -
C# 单纯暂停线程(Thread.Sleep方法)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ace UsingSleep{ //Thread是实例类,但包含实例成员和静态成员。调用静态成...原创 2019-02-15 11:24:59 · 7214 阅读 · 0 评论 -
C# 暂停A线程执行B线程(Thread.Join方法)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5005_暂停A线程执行B线程_Thread.Join方法_{ class Usin...原创 2019-02-15 11:25:34 · 796 阅读 · 0 评论 -
C# 判断线程是否结束Alive
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5006_判断线程是否结束Alive{ class UsingIsAlive ...原创 2019-02-15 22:07:45 · 10046 阅读 · 0 评论 -
C# 避免资源访问冲突锁定当前线程_Lock
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5007_避免资源访问冲突锁定当前线程_Lock_{ class UsingLock...原创 2019-02-15 22:08:21 · 831 阅读 · 0 评论 -
C# 比Lock更强大的线程控制类Mointer
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5008_比Lock更强大的线程控制类Mointer{ class UsingMoi...原创 2019-02-15 22:08:53 · 483 阅读 · 0 评论 -
C# 终止线程Interrupt_让线程死
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5009_终止线程Interrupt_让线程死_{ class KillingThr...原创 2019-02-15 22:09:22 · 1201 阅读 · 0 评论 -
C# ClsThreadPool_线程池
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5010_ClsThreadPool_线程池_{ public class ClsT...原创 2019-02-15 22:09:54 · 177 阅读 · 0 评论 -
C# ThreadJoin_Jion讲解
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ace _5011_ThreadJoin_Jion讲解_{ class TestThread...原创 2019-02-15 22:10:27 · 102 阅读 · 0 评论 -
C# 线程名称ShowThreadName(线程操作类Thread)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;class ShowThreadName{ static void Main(string[] args)...原创 2019-02-15 22:11:25 · 2813 阅读 · 0 评论 -
多线程SingleThread(单一线程执行器), 可替代 在共享资源上同步
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ace SingleThread{ class SingleThread { ...原创 2019-02-16 15:51:39 · 1454 阅读 · 0 评论 -
C# 多线程(委托ThreadStart)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Threading;namespace CreateThreading{ class Program { ...原创 2019-02-16 15:52:15 · 3561 阅读 · 0 评论 -
C# 文件目录的操作DirectoryInfo
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.IO;//输入输出流命名空间namespace _6001_文件目录的操作DirectoryInfo{ class Using...原创 2019-02-16 15:52:55 · 2655 阅读 · 0 评论 -
C#文件操作基础之File类和FileInfo类
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.IO;public class MaintainFile{ private int IntModify()//主要判断用户要操...原创 2019-02-16 15:53:35 · 754 阅读 · 0 评论 -
C# 复制文件内容Stream类
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.IO;class StreamRWTest{ public static void Main() { ...原创 2019-02-16 15:54:11 · 1157 阅读 · 0 评论 -
C# 内存数据流操作类MemoryStream
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.IO;namespace _6004_内存数据流操作类MemoryStream{ class MemoryRWTest ...原创 2019-02-16 15:54:43 · 1567 阅读 · 0 评论 -
C# 二进制文件内容读取类BinaryReader(读取图片文件或者二进制文本)
读取文件界面using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;usi...原创 2019-02-16 15:56:42 · 4795 阅读 · 0 评论 -
C# 文件数据流内容读取类StreamReader
程序设计界面using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;usi...原创 2019-02-16 16:04:09 · 2074 阅读 · 0 评论 -
C# 二进制文件内容写入类BinaryWriter
程序设计界面using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;usi...原创 2019-02-16 16:05:26 · 2105 阅读 · 0 评论 -
C# 文件数据流内容写入类StreamWriter
程序设计界面using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Linq;using System.Text;using System.Threading.Tasks;usi...原创 2019-02-16 16:06:54 · 1418 阅读 · 0 评论 -
C# 获取主机名HostName
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Net;namespace _7001_获取主机名HostName{ class Program { ...原创 2019-02-16 16:07:35 · 2613 阅读 · 0 评论 -
C# 获取指定IP地址与主机名称的相互解析
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Net;using System.Net.Sockets;namespace _7002_IP地址与主机名称的相互解析{ c...原创 2019-02-16 16:08:12 · 1364 阅读 · 3 评论 -
C# TcpClient类实现通信端口的扫描
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Net.Sockets;//系统网络编程接口命名空间using System.Threading;//套接字 IP地:端口names...原创 2019-02-16 16:08:53 · 1330 阅读 · 0 评论 -
C# 序列化反序列化综合案例
using System;using System.IO;using System.Runtime.Serialization;using System.Runtime.Serialization.Formatters.Binary;using System.Runtime.Serialization.Formatters.Soap;//一个格式//C:\Windows\Micros...原创 2019-02-16 16:09:31 · 202 阅读 · 0 评论 -
C# is运算符测试类型
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ace A001_is运算符测试类型{ class A { } class B : A { } class M...原创 2019-02-16 16:37:25 · 309 阅读 · 0 评论 -
C# AS类型转换_若不成功不出错_返回NULL
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ace A002_AS类型转换_若不成功不出错_返回NULL{ class A { } class B : A {...原创 2019-02-16 16:38:00 · 1445 阅读 · 0 评论 -
C# GetType获取对象的数据类型
using System;using System.Collections.Generic;using System.Linq;using System.Text;namespace A004_GetType获取对象的数据类型{ class GetTypeTest { static void Main() { ...原创 2019-02-16 16:38:29 · 1816 阅读 · 0 评论 -
C# 使用反射获取方法的相关信息
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Reflection;namespace 使用反射获取方法的相关信息{ class Myclass //自定义我的类 ...原创 2019-02-16 16:39:05 · 632 阅读 · 0 评论 -
C# 反射TypeOf返回【类】的类型02(方法与方法的参数列表,限制性)
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Reflection;// 反射命名空间using System.Reflection.Emit;using System.Thread...原创 2019-02-16 16:39:43 · 1050 阅读 · 0 评论 -
C# TypeOf返回类的类型
using System; using System.Collections.Generic; using System.Text; using System.Reflection;namespace TypeOf返回类的类型{ class Test//测试类 { public int IntName; public sta...原创 2019-02-16 16:40:20 · 2829 阅读 · 0 评论